The era of the recommendation engine is giving way to the age of the generative algorithm. As industry titans like Netflix, Spotify, and Epic Games move beyond merely suggesting content to actively manufacturing it in real-time, the entertainment landscape is facing its most significant structural shift since the dawn of the internet.

For the better part of two decades, the "holy grail" of digital entertainment was the recommendation engine. From Netflix’s "Top Picks for You" to Spotify’s "Discover Weekly," the goal of every major platform was to sift through a vast, static library of content to find the closest match for a user’s specific taste. However, this model had an inherent limitation: it could only serve what already existed. If the "perfect" piece of content for a specific user at a specific moment had not been filmed, recorded, or programmed, the algorithm failed.

As of August 2026, that limitation is rapidly dissolving. Generative Artificial Intelligence (AI) is closing the gap between consumer desire and content availability by creating bespoke experiences around the individual. This shift—from matching a person to a product, to building a product for a person—is redefining the economics of the creator economy, the architecture of gaming, and the future of global advertising.

Chronology of a Revolution: The Path to Generative Media

The transition to generative entertainment did not happen overnight, but rather through a series of high-stakes pivots and technological breakthroughs occurring over the past twelve months.

December 2025: The industry reached a fever pitch when OpenAI and Disney announced a landmark $1 billion equity agreement. The deal was designed to allow Disney+ subscribers to use OpenAI’s video generation tool, Sora, to create high-fidelity "fan videos" using iconic characters from the Marvel, Star Wars, and Pixar universes. This represented the first major attempt by a legacy media conglomerate to hand the "keys to the kingdom" to the audience.

March 2026: The Disney-OpenAI deal collapsed. OpenAI abruptly shut down the Sora platform to pivot toward "agentic tools" and high-productivity coding AI. Disney withdrew its investment before capital was exchanged, highlighting the immense difficulty of balancing generative freedom with brand safety and intellectual property protection.

May 2026: Spotify used its 2026 Investor Day to signal a new direction. Co-CEO Gustav Söderström introduced the "Large Taste Model" (LTM), marking the company’s evolution from an access-based platform to a generative one. Simultaneously, Netflix began reporting significant success in its AI-generated advertising tests, signaling that the "generative pivot" was finding its most profitable early use cases in the ad-supported tiers.

July 30, 2026: Epic Games officially rolled out its "Conversations" feature for Fortnite island creators. By integrating Large Language Models (LLMs) directly into the game’s architecture, Epic effectively ended the era of scripted Non-Player Characters (NPCs), allowing for a world that reacts dynamically to every player’s unique input.

Supporting Data: The Scale of Individualization

The shift toward generative content is backed by massive datasets and significant capital infusions.

  • 3.4 Trillion Signals: Spotify’s "Large Taste Model" is trained on a staggering 3.4 trillion daily signals. These include skips, replays, time-of-day listening habits, and cross-genre correlations across music, podcasts, and audiobooks. This data is no longer being used just to suggest a playlist; it is being used to generate "remixes" and individualized audio environments that adapt to a listener’s heart rate or activity level.
  • $60 Million Series B: Kaon AI, a startup specializing in narrative video generation, recently closed a $60 million funding round. Unlike Netflix, which hosts a library of files, Kaon’s engine generates a distinct story world for each viewer in real-time.
  • The Ad Efficiency Metric: Netflix’s internal testing with brands like DoorDash, Target, and TurboTax revealed that AI-generated ad creative—which matches the color palette and "vibe" of the show currently being watched—saw a double-digit increase in "execution quality" and viewer retention compared to generic 30-second spots.

Breaking the Script: Fortnite and the Rise of Reactive Worlds

The rollout of AI-powered conversations in Fortnite serves as a primary case study for how generative AI changes the user experience. Historically, video game characters were limited by "dialogue trees"—a finite set of responses written by a human designer.

With the new "Conversations" feature, developers provide a simple personality prompt (e.g., "You are a weary space explorer who is suspicious of strangers but obsessed with trading rare minerals"). The AI then generates responses in real-time based on what the player says via text or voice.

This creates a "non-linear" entertainment experience. Two players can approach the same character and have entirely different interactions, leading to different quest outcomes and narrative paths. This move by Epic Games essentially turns every player into a co-author of the game’s story, a move that is expected to significantly increase "time-spent" metrics across the platform.

Official Responses: The Vision from the C-Suite

Leaders in the space are framing this shift as an inevitable evolution of digital media.

Jay Dang, CEO and Co-Founder of Kaon AI, emphasized the limitation of the previous era in a recent interview with PYMNTS: "If the perfect piece of content for the user was never made, the algorithm cannot help the user. We are moving to a world where the algorithm doesn’t just find the needle in the haystack; it grows the needle."

At Spotify, Gustav Söderström described the path as a "clear trajectory from access to personalization, and now to generation." For Spotify, the goal is to move away from being a "music player" to being an "audio companion" that can synthesize new sounds based on the listener’s immediate emotional needs.

In the advertising sector, Netflix has been more pragmatic. While the company has been tight-lipped about the specific underlying models, spokespeople have confirmed that the goal is "dynamic matching." By the end of 2026, Netflix plans to expand its AI-generated ad tools to all ad-supported regions, aiming to make advertising feel like a seamless extension of the cinematic experience rather than an intrusion.

The Implications: Why "Infinite Content" is a Harder Problem

Despite the excitement, the collapse of the Disney-OpenAI Sora deal serves as a stark reminder of the "Harder Problem" inherent in generative media. Moving from a fixed library to a generative one introduces three primary challenges:

1. The Compute Paradox

Generating a unique video or audio stream for every individual user requires an exponential increase in "compute" (processing power). While streaming a pre-recorded file from a server is relatively cheap, "rendering" a new story world or a complex AI dialogue in real-time is incredibly expensive. The industry must find a way to make the cost-per-minute of generative content lower than the ad revenue or subscription fees it generates—a balance that has not yet been fully achieved.

2. The Brand Safety and Moderation Minefield

When content is generated on the fly, the risk of "hallucinations"—where the AI produces nonsensical, offensive, or off-brand material—is high. Disney’s withdrawal from the Sora project was largely attributed to these concerns. Even with a "joint steering committee" and a "brand appendix," the sheer volume of user-generated content makes manual moderation impossible. For a company like Disney, the risk of a beloved character being generated in a "non-brand-safe" context outweighs the potential $1 billion in equity.

3. The Death of the "Watercooler Moment"

If every person is watching a different version of a movie or playing a different version of a game, the shared cultural experience—the "watercooler moment"—threatens to disappear. Entertainment has historically been a social glue; the shift to total individualization could atomize the audience, making it harder for brands and creators to build massive, unified fanbases.

Conclusion: The New Frontier

As we move toward the end of 2026, the entertainment industry is effectively bifurcating. On one side sits "Prestige Media"—high-budget, human-made, static content that serves as a collective cultural touchstone. On the other side is "Generative Media"—fluid, AI-driven, and hyper-personalized experiences that adapt to the user in real-time.

The success of Fortnite’s NPCs and Netflix’s dynamic ads suggests that the generative model is here to stay. However, the cautionary tale of Disney and Sora proves that the road to "infinite content" is paved with technical and ethical hurdles. The companies that survive this transition will be those that can master the "Large Taste Models" while maintaining the guardrails that keep their brands—and their budgets—intact.
